Continuing Education Program Specialist Salary in Skokie, IL

How much does a Continuing Education Program Specialist make in Skokie, IL?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Continuing Education Program Specialist in Skokie, IL is $63,013 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$30.

However, a Continuing Education Program Specialist's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$76,711
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$54,963 to $70,183
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$47,634

Key Factors That Influence Continuing Education Program Specialist Salaries

A Continuing Education Program Specialist's salary isn't a fixed number. It's shaped by several important factors. Below, we'll explore how your years of experience, geographic location, and company size can directly affect your earning potential.

How Experience Level Affects Continuing Education Program Specialist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Continuing Education Program Specialist's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here's how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$59,422
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$60,023
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$61,225
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$65,168
  • Expert (over 8 years): $67,095

Continuing Education Program Specialist Salary by Company Size: Startups vs. Enterprise

Continuing Education Program Specialist salary potential scales significantly with company size. Data shows that Enterprise companies (5,000+ employees) pay the highest average salary at around $68,201. While startup companies pay approximate $57,829.

Continuing Education Program Specialist Salary by Company Size

Company Size Employees Average Salary
Startup1~50$57,829
Growth Stage51~500$61,126
Established501~5000$65,890
Enterprise5000+$68,201

Continuing Education Program Specialist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Continuing Education Program Specialist ro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 40%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Healthcare and Edu., Gov't. & Nonprofit s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 20% above the average. In contrast, Continuing Education Program Specialist positions in Insurance or Financial Services typ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Continuing Education Program Specialist as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
